Who We Are

American Arbor was built on a simple belief: the way you do the work matters just as much as the work itself.

Owner Levi Thompson grew up in Starkville, Mississippi, spending as much time outside as he could. It wasn’t long before that love of the outdoors turned into a love for climbing trees and learning the trade. Over the years, Levi worked alongside experienced crews and contract climbed for tree companies throughout the region, building the skill, experience, and perspective that would eventually shape American Arbor.

All along, he had a vision for building something of his own and a conviction about how it should be run.

“Whatever you do, do it unto the Lord.”

For Levi, that isn’t just a slogan. It’s the standard American Arbor is measured against.

He started American Arbor to build the kind of tree company he would want to hire for his own family: one that prioritizes safety, does the job right the first time, tells the truth even when a lie would be easier, and treats every customer’s property with the same care he would want for his own.

Because when a tree is leaning toward a house or a heavy limb hangs over a roof, it’s more than a landscaping concern. It’s a homeowner wondering whether their home, their vehicle, or their family is at risk. Those decisions deserve to be handled by professionals you can trust.

Levi sees the skill he’s developed through years of climbing, cutting, and working alongside experienced arborists as something he’s been given, and that shapes the way he uses it: to provide for his family, serve his community, and honor God through his work.

We’re here to do good work, take care of people, and do it all with purpose.
